From that point he rarely strayed from that path; scribbling and doodling his way through School, College and University. After working with Porlzilla, Jon-Paul decided to go it alone concentrating at first on the toy customization scene, building up a name and strong reputation for himself with his stark Black & White custom style, influenced by comic book art, film noir & Ukiyo-e prints. This lead to him being approached by established toy producers for designs for their platform toys. Principally amongst these are Toy2R who have released numerous JPK Platforms.
